How Cloud Storage Works and Its Role in Data Management
Cloud storage sits at the center of modern computing, quietly ensuring that photos appear on every device, analytics jobs finish overnight, and teams collaborate from anywhere. Beyond convenience, it is a foundational layer of data management that influences security, governance, cost, and performance. Understanding how it works can help you design resilient systems, control spending, and protect the information that keeps your organization running.
This article opens the lid on how cloud storage is structured and how it behaves under the hood. We will connect architecture to day‑to‑day data management choices, from the way you classify information to the policies that keep it safe and compliant. Whether you operate a small startup or a global enterprise, the principles are the same: know your data, align it to the right storage model, and use automation to keep it healthy across its lifecycle.
Outline:
– Building blocks of cloud storage: object, file, and block models, metadata, and consistency
– The data path: upload, encryption, chunking, replication, and retrieval
– Durability and availability: redundancy, erasure coding, tiers, and trade‑offs
– Security and compliance: identity, policies, encryption keys, and auditing
– Conclusion: mapping cloud storage to a practical data management strategy
From Disks to Objects: The Building Blocks of Cloud Storage
Cloud storage aggregates thousands of disks across clusters, data centers, and regions, then presents them through logical models that applications can use. At its core are three primary models, each optimized for a different pattern of access and consistency. Understanding them helps you decide what fits your workload—and what future changes will cost in time and money.
– Object storage: Data is stored as discrete objects with rich metadata in flat namespaces. Instead of directories, you address content via keys or URLs, enabling virtually unlimited scale. It excels at write‑once, read‑many scenarios such as static websites, data lakes, backups, and media archives. Typical traits include high durability, flexible metadata indexing, and eventual or configurable consistency for some operations.
– File storage: Data is presented as shared folders via standard file protocols. This model preserves familiar semantics like hierarchical paths, file locks, and permissions, making it well suited for content management, creative workflows, and home directories. Performance scales with allocated throughput and capacity, and it often offers strong consistency that legacy applications expect.
– Block storage: Volumes are attached to compute instances and exposed as raw block devices. Databases, low‑latency transactional systems, and high‑performance workloads benefit from predictable IOPS and microsecond‑to‑millisecond latency characteristics. Snapshots and clones allow quick backups and environment copies without moving entire datasets.
Behind these models are services for metadata, indexing, and placement. Metadata catalogs track object keys, sizes, custom tags, and checksums. Placement engines distribute data across fault domains—racks, nodes, and availability zones—to avoid correlated failures. For large objects, data is chunked into parts, enabling parallel uploads and targeted retries. Many platforms use content hashing to detect corruption, while background scrubbing repairs bit rot proactively. Consistency models vary: some systems offer read‑after‑write for new objects and eventual consistency for overwrites; others provide strong consistency across operations, often with trade‑offs in latency or throughput.
The net effect is a storage fabric that appears simple—put data, get data—while concealing the complexity of scale. When choosing among object, file, and block, consider how your application reads and writes, the level of namespace control you need, and tolerance for latency. As a rule of thumb: object for scalability and rich metadata, file for shared team workflows, and block for transactional speed.
What Happens When You Click Upload: Inside the Data Path
Uploading to the cloud triggers a choreography of network handshakes, validation steps, and background processes designed to keep data safe and make it quickly retrievable. While the experience feels instantaneous, dozens of safeguards and optimizations kick in between your device and the final resting place of the bits.
The journey begins with a secure connection. Your client initiates a handshake using modern transport security, which negotiates ciphers and establishes encryption in transit. Authentication and authorization follow, typically via access keys, tokens, or signed requests that determine whether your identity can perform a write operation on the target path. Many clients support multipart uploads, splitting large files into chunks—say 5 to 128 MB each—so failures can be retried part by part without restarting the entire transfer.
As data flows, the client and service compute checksums to detect corruption. The service may apply compression based on content type, then immediately encrypt the data at rest using a managed key or a customer‑supplied key. Placement policies distribute the pieces across different storage nodes and, often, across distinct availability zones within a region. For object storage, a manifest records part numbers, checksums, and metadata such as content type, creation time, retention policy, and custom tags.
– Typical pipeline stages:
– Request and authenticate the operation
– Negotiate secure transport and start streaming data
– Chunk the payload and compute checksums per part
– Encrypt and place data across failure domains
– Acknowledge completion with an identifier and integrity tag
Once stored, background services handle replication or erasure coding based on the class you selected. Indexers update the metadata catalog so listings and searches are fast. Lifecycle engines evaluate your rules—for example, “move to a cooler tier after 30 days” or “expire after three years.” If you enabled immutability, a write‑once lock prevents changes until the retention date, a vital control for audit trails and ransomware recovery.
Retrieval mirrors the upload in reverse. The system resolves the key, checks authorization, assembles parts if needed, and streams back the content, often leveraging edge caches for frequently accessed objects. Latency depends on distance to the region, network quality, and the tier; hot classes respond in tens of milliseconds locally, while archival classes may require minutes to stage. The result is a system that gracefully balances speed, integrity, and cost, while keeping the user experience simple.
Durability, Availability, and Tiers: How Clouds Keep Data Safe
Two promises define the reliability of storage: durability and availability. Durability is the probability your data remains intact over time; availability is the probability the service is reachable when you need it. Cloud providers engineer for both by distributing data across hardware, racks, and zones, then adding math and monitoring to detect and heal faults automatically.
Replication is the most familiar strategy: keep multiple complete copies. A common profile is three replicas across separate fault domains. If a disk fails, repairs proceed from healthy copies with no user involvement. Erasure coding takes a different path, splitting data into fragments plus parity shards—examples include 6+3 or 10+4 layouts—allowing recovery even if several pieces are missing. Erasure coding typically delivers equal or higher durability at lower storage overhead than plain replication, though it can add latency and CPU overhead during rebuilds.
Durability targets for standard object storage classes are often marketed at nine to eleven nines annually, achieved through continuous scrubbing, checksum verification, and background repairs. Availability targets frequently land around 99.9% to 99.99% per month for single‑region classes, with multi‑zone or multi‑region options pushing higher. Actual results depend on design and operations, but the core engineering pattern—defense in depth—remains steady: isolate failures, detect them quickly, and heal automatically.
Tiers add an economic and performance dimension. Hot storage prioritizes low latency and high throughput for active datasets. Cool or infrequent‑access tiers reduce cost for data that is read occasionally, with slightly higher access fees. Archive tiers push prices down further but introduce retrieval delays ranging from minutes to hours. Choosing the right tier is a lifecycle decision: keep fresh data hot, demote aging data as access patterns decline, and archive records that must be retained for compliance or historical value.
– Practical guidance:
– Replication for write‑heavy, latency‑sensitive workloads; erasure coding for large, mostly read workloads
– Hot tier for active data; cool tier for periodic access; archive for long‑term retention
– Consider recovery objectives: RPO (how much data you can lose) and RTO (how quickly you must recover)
Geo‑replication extends protection against regional incidents and supports low‑latency access for distributed teams, but it introduces trade‑offs: higher cost, potential consistency considerations, and the need to respect data residency requirements. The key is to align redundancy methods with business goals. Not every file deserves multi‑region protection, but records underpinning revenue, safety, or legal obligations often do.
Security, Governance, and Compliance: Controlling Access and Risk
Security in cloud storage is a layered practice that blends technology, policy, and habit. The goal is simple to state and complex to execute: only the right people and systems should access the right data, at the right time, for the right reasons. Done well, these controls reduce breach risk, limit blast radius, and make audits faster.
Start with identity and authorization. Use least‑privilege roles, scoped to the smallest set of actions and paths. Prefer short‑lived, rotated credentials and avoid embedding secrets in code. Resource policies and access control lists should be explicit and deny‑by‑default, with clear exceptions for public content such as web assets. Network controls—like private endpoints and restricted routing—keep traffic off the public internet where possible.
Encryption provides a strong second line. Data in transit should use modern transport security with current protocol versions. At rest, widely adopted ciphers such as AES‑256 protect content if disks are lost or stolen. Key management is pivotal: decide whether to use a managed key service or customer‑supplied keys, define rotation schedules, and apply separation of duties so no single administrator can view both plaintext data and keys.
– Baseline controls to implement:
– Multi‑factor authentication for administrators and automation accounts
– Versioning plus object‑level immutability (WORM) for ransomware resilience
– Lifecycle rules that expire stale objects and reduce accidental exposure
– Detailed access logs piped to write‑protected storage for audit trails
– Automated scans for sensitive data patterns to support privacy obligations
Compliance overlays these mechanics with formal requirements. Privacy laws may dictate where data can reside, how long you can keep it, and how quickly you must delete it on request. Sector rules in healthcare, finance, and education add retention, encryption, and audit stipulations. Meeting them requires data classification—labeling records as public, internal, confidential, or restricted—so policies apply consistently. Immutability features and legal holds support investigations without halting day‑to‑day operations.
Finally, practice resilience. Follow a 3‑2‑1 recovery pattern: three copies of important data, on two different media or services, with one copy offsite and logically isolated. Run restore drills regularly; a backup you haven’t tested is a hope, not a plan. By combining least privilege, strong encryption, immutability, and tested recovery, you turn cloud storage from a passive repository into an active control that reduces operational and regulatory risk.
Putting It All Together: Cloud Storage’s Role in Modern Data Management
Cloud storage is more than a place to park files; it is the connective tissue of data management. It enables ingestion at scale for analytics, supports collaboration for creative teams, underpins backups and disaster recovery, and provides an archive for records that must outlive the systems that created them. The challenge is orchestration: matching data to the right model and tier, automating lifecycle transitions, and governing access without slowing people down.
A practical roadmap helps. Begin with a data inventory and classification exercise. Identify hot datasets that require low latency, cool datasets that see periodic access, and archival obligations driven by policy. Map each category to object, file, or block storage, then set lifecycle rules such as “transition to cool after 30 days, archive after 180, delete after seven years unless under legal hold.” Define RPO and RTO targets for each class so you know where to invest in replication, snapshots, or geo‑redundancy.
– An actionable plan:
– Assess: catalog datasets, owners, sensitivity, and access patterns
– Architect: select storage models, tiers, regions, and redundancy strategies
– Secure: apply least privilege, encryption, and immutability where needed
– Operate: monitor cost, performance, and access; refine lifecycle rules
– Test: run restores and failovers to validate recovery objectives
Cost control deserves continuous attention. Storage charges accumulate quietly, while request and egress fees can surprise teams during migrations or peak downloads. Use budgets and alerts, surface unit costs to project owners, and prefer designs that process data where it resides to reduce movement. Lifecycle automation is a reliable lever: tier down aging data, expire versions older than policy requires, and delete duplicate or orphaned artifacts produced by pipelines.
For leaders and practitioners alike, the takeaway is balanced ambition. Aim for architectures that are simple to operate, transparent to audit, and flexible enough to evolve. Start with a small pilot that exercises uploads, lifecycle transitions, restores, and access reviews; then scale the pattern across teams. When storage choices are tied to data value and business outcomes, you gain resilience, clarity, and efficiency—benefits that compound as your data grows.